The last 48 hours has been the worst days of bushfires in Australian History since records began 150 years ago. These fires have been dubbed 'Hell on Earth'. The fires are worse than the fires of Black Friday and Ash Wednesday.
February 7th was a day of extreme heat, topping over 47 Celsius (117 Fahrenheit). This was on top of three consecutive days of over 44 degree heat. The predictable and worst happened, fires. Fires sprouted all over Victoria, North, East and West. The fires were caused by extreme heat, arsons, cigarette butts and even lightning strikes.
